Get started10 Oxford Avenue is a mid-terrace house in Southampton (SO14 0BP). It has a recorded floor area of 102 m² (around 1098 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2020)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since August 2013.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77).
Held since July 2001 — that's 25 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Sale prices here have outpaced Southampton HPI: 20.3%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£223,000 sits 175.3% above the 2001 sale of £81,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£74/sq ft) was about 47.5% below the postcode norm. 3 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 2 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
